By Car
Please note, that because the University is a working campus with many staff and students, car parking may be limited before 4pm, so please arrive in plenty of time to secure a space.
Therefore car parking is restricted before 4pm Monday - Friday.
There are limited car parking spaces available directly behind Taliesin. Simply enter from the front of Swansea University, taking a left at the crossroads before Fulton Hall and then take a right hand turn and follow the road to the car park. There is some Blue Badge parking in this vicinity also and you can see HERE for a visual tour of the car park and into our centre! We would stress that because the University is a working campus with many staff and students, car parking may be limited before 4pm, so please arrive in plenty of time to secure a space.
By Bus – The Taliesin can be reached on many frequent bus routes from Swansea City Centre. Swansea University is a regular stop on the 4/4a/3a/8/10 bus routes, all of which stop directly outside or just adjacent to the Fulton House building. With Fulton House directly in front of you, turn to the right hand side and walk down the path, where Taliesin is around 100m from the bus stop on the left hand side. You can choose to enter either via the doors and at the front of the building or via the back entrance, and inside the building there is a lift to the first floor, where our box office and auditorium are.
On foot - Taliesin is situated on the Swansea University Singleton Campus and can also be reached through Singleton Park.
